Transaction 23831510839c7c6ed8a87d6aba1de7197b57e20618b5246f0e45ae5e2940aa2b
1 Input
1 Output
-
23831510839c7c6ed8a87d6aba1de7197b57e20618b5246f0e45ae5e2940aa2b:0
- value
- 29965
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8a79fd9a1b24acef1ce3fa136194f0832eee94eb9bb372480572b06fbaf45fd7
- address
- bc1p3fulmxsmyjkw788rlgfkr98ssvhwa98tnwehyjq9w2cxlwh5tltsr8vukc